Part Overview

The MAX6225BESA is a Series, Buried Zener Voltage Reference IC manufactured by Analog Devices Inc./Maxim Integrated. This component provides a fixed 2.5V output with ±0.12% tolerance and is designed for precision voltage reference applications requiring low noise and stable performance across industrial temperature ranges. The part is currently classified as Obsolete, making identification of suitable substitutes essential for ongoing system support and new design implementations.

Key Parameters

Parameter Specification
Manufacturer Part Number MAX6225BESA
Manufacturer Analog Devices Inc./Maxim Integrated
Reference Type Series, Buried Zener
Output Voltage (Fixed) 2.5V
Output Current 15 mA
Voltage Tolerance ±0.12%
Temperature Coefficient 7 ppm/°C
Noise (0.1Hz to 10Hz) 1.5 µVp-p
Noise (10Hz to 10kHz) 1.3 µVrms
Input Voltage Range 8V ~ 36V
Supply Current 3 mA
Operating Temperature -40°C ~ 85°C (TA)
Package Type 8-SOIC (0.154", 3.90mm Width)
Mounting Type Surface Mount
Product Status Obsolete

Engineering Selection Recommendations

The MAX6225BESA+ is the direct equivalent substitute for the MAX6225BESA. Both parts maintain identical electrical and mechanical specifications, ensuring functional compatibility in existing circuit designs. The MAX6225BESA+ is classified as Active product status, providing long-term availability and supply chain continuity compared to the Obsolete status of the original part.

The MAX6225BESA+ achieves ROHS3 compliance, whereas the MAX6225BESA is RoHS non-compliant. This distinction is significant for applications subject to regulatory requirements or procurement policies mandating RoHS compliance. Both parts carry REACH Unaffected status and EAR99 export classification.

Selection between these parts should be based on regulatory requirements, supply availability, and procurement specifications. The MAX6225BESA+ is the recommended choice for new designs and ongoing production due to its Active status and improved compliance posture.
